Debora Impera is an Associate Professor at the Department of Mathematical Sciences of the Polytechnic University of Turin. She is a member of the Functional Analysis and Differential Geometry research group and has held a tenure-track assistant professor (Ricercatore di tipo B) position at the same university prior to her current role.
Her research focuses on Differential Geometry and Geometric Analysis, particularly on Riemannian manifolds and mean curvature flow. Key areas include:
- Geometric rigidity theorems
- Self-shrinkers and translators
- Sobolev spaces and cut-off functions
- Topological constraints in geometric PDEs
Her recent publications (2025-2016) span journals like Calculus of Variational PDEs, International Mathematics Research Notices, and The Journal of Geometric Analysis, with recurring themes of Ricci curvature, isoperimetric inequalities, and topological rigidity.
Debora teaches courses such as:
- Differential Geometry (Mathematics for Engineering, 2024/25 and 2025/26)
- Linear Algebra and Geometry (Aerospace Engineering, Management Engineering, etc.)
- Problem Solving Lab 2 (Aerospace Engineering, 2020/21)
